§ 74-603 — DEFINITIONS

Idaho·Title 74 TRANSPARENT AND ETHICAL GOVERNMENT·Ch. 6 PUBLIC INTEGRITY IN ELECTIONS ACT

As used in this chapter:

(1)(a) "Advocate" means to campaign for or against a candidate or the outcome of a ballot measure.
(b)"Advocate" does not mean providing factual information about a ballot measure and the public entity’s reason for the ballot measure stated in a factually neutral manner. Factual information includes but is not limited to the cost of indebtedness, intended purpose, condition of property to be addressed, date and location of election, qualifications of candidates, or other applicable information necessary to provide transparency to electors.
(2)"Ballot measure" means constitutional amendments, bond measures, or levy measures.
